Wine Festival Entertainment: Houston Pricing Breakdown
DJ Services: $800 – $2,500
A professional DJ sets the tone of your wine festival — sophisticated jazz and bossa nova during tastings, smooth house and Latin rhythms as the evening unfolds. Pricing depends on package length, equipment scale, and whether MC duties are included.
- $800 – $1,200: 4-hour DJ with basic sound (up to 150 guests)
- $1,300 – $1,800: 5-6 hour DJ with premium sound + uplighting
- $1,900 – $2,500: Full event DJ with MC duties + dance floor lighting
Live Musician Add-Ons
Live music elevates a wine festival from event to atmosphere. Pair these with your DJ for seamless transitions between tasting hours and reception.
- Saxophonist: $700 – $1,500 (2-3 sets layered over DJ)
- Vocalist: $900 – $2,000 (jazz, soul, or Latin standards)
- Acoustic guitarist: $600 – $1,200
- String duo or trio: $1,200 – $2,800
MC / Host Services: $500 – $1,500
A polished MC keeps your festival on schedule — introducing wine pairings, hosting raffles, announcing sommelier sessions, and engaging guests between performances. Bilingual English/Spanish hosts available for Houston's diverse audiences.

Budget Tiers
Tier 1 — Essentials ($1,500 – $3,000)
DJ + MC combo. Ideal for boutique tastings under 150 guests in private venues with existing sound systems.
Tier 2 — Production ($4,500 – $8,000)
DJ + saxophonist + MC + mid-tier KLAV AV. The sweet spot for most Houston wine festivals at venues like rooftop spaces, wineries, and event halls.
Tier 3 — Full Experience ($10,000 – $18,500)
DJ + vocalist + saxophonist + MC + full KLAV production. Designed for signature festivals, brand launches, and corporate-sponsored events expecting 500+ guests.
Tips for Getting Maximum Value
- Book bundled. Combining DJ, live musicians, MC, and AV through one provider unlocks 15-25% savings versus piecing it together.
- Lock dates 60+ days out. Weekend rates rise sharply within 30 days of an event.
- Mid-week wine festivals save up to 20% on talent fees.
- Confirm venue power and load-in. Insufficient power forces last-minute generator rentals at premium prices.
- Request demo reels — never book entertainment sight-unseen.
Questions to Ask Before Booking
- What is included — and what triggers add-on fees?
- Do you carry liability insurance and provide a certificate of insurance?
- Who is the on-site contact the day of the event?
- What is the cancellation, weather, and overtime policy?
- Can you provide references from comparable wine or hospitality events?
- Is backup equipment included?
